Mastering SQL with MySQL: Complete Beginner to Advanced Course Guide (2026)
Master SQL with MySQL step by step. Beginner to advanced course guide with real-world skills, career benefits, and learning roadmap for 2026. In the modern digital ecosystem, data plays a critical role in decision-making, automation, and application development. Every website, mobile app, software platform, and online service relies on databases to store and process information. To work efficiently with databases, one skill stands above the rest — SQL.
SQL (Structured Query Language) is the backbone of relational database systems, and among all database technologies, MySQL remains one of the most widely used and trusted platforms worldwide. From startups to global enterprises, MySQL powers countless applications across industries.
For learners who want to build strong database skills from scratch and progress toward advanced expertise, the Udemy course “Mastering SQL with MySQL: From Basics to Advanced” offers a structured and practical learning path. This course focuses on clarity, hands-on practice, and real-world database usage, making it suitable for both beginners and working professionals.
This in-depth article explains what the course covers, why SQL and MySQL matter in today’s job market, who should enroll, and how mastering these skills can unlock long-term career growth.
Why SQL Is a Must-Have Skill in 2026 and Beyond : Mastering SQL with MySQL
SQL is not just another programming language — Mastering SQL with MySQL, it is a universal standard for working with relational databases. Regardless of whether you are a developer, analyst, engineer, or business professional, SQL allows you to interact directly with stored data.
With SQL, you can:
- Extract meaningful information from massive datasets
- Add, modify, or remove records safely
- Organize data efficiently using tables and relationships
- Perform calculations and summaries for reporting
- Optimize databases for speed and reliability
What makes SQL especially valuable is its cross-platform relevance. Once you understand SQL fundamentals, you can apply them to MySQL, PostgreSQL, SQL Server, Oracle, and other database systems with minimal adjustments.
MySQL is often the first choice for learners because it is open-source, widely supported, and used in real production environments. Learning SQL with MySQL gives you practical experience that directly translates into real-world jobs.
Course Overview: Learning SQL with MySQL Step by Step :Mastering SQL with MySQL
The “Mastering SQL with MySQL: From Basics to Advanced” course is designed to eliminate confusion and help learners progress logically. Instead of overwhelming students with theory, the course builds concepts gradually while reinforcing them through practice.
Core Learning Stages in the Course: Mastering SQL with MySQL
1. SQL and Database Foundations
The course begins with the basics, ensuring learners fully understand:
- What relational databases are
- How tables store structured data
- How rows, columns, and keys work together
- The role of SQL in database interaction
This foundation is crucial, especially for beginners who have never worked with databases before.
2. Creating and Managing Databases
Once the basics are clear, learners move on to database creation and management, including:
- Creating databases and tables
- Choosing appropriate data types
- Defining primary keys and constraints
- Understanding database structure and integrity
These lessons teach how professional databases are designed rather than just how queries are written.
3. Writing Essential SQL Queries
This section focuses on everyday SQL operations used in real jobs:
- Retrieving data using SELECT statements
- Filtering results using conditions
- Sorting and limiting output
- Inserting new records
- Updating existing data
- Deleting unwanted records safely
By practicing these commands, learners gain confidence in handling real datasets.
4. Working with Multiple Tables
Modern databases rarely consist of a single table. This course explains how to:
- Connect tables using relationships
- Use different types of joins
- Combine data from multiple sources
- Avoid duplicate or inconsistent records
This part of the course is essential for understanding how complex systems store data efficiently.
5. Advanced SQL Techniques
As learners progress, the course introduces advanced topics such as:
- Subqueries and nested queries
- Aggregate functions for calculations
- Grouping and summarizing data
- Conditional logic within SQL
These skills are commonly tested in interviews and used in professional environments.
6. Database Performance and Optimization
Poorly written queries can slow down applications. This course explains:
- How indexing improves query speed
- Best practices for writing efficient SQL
- How to handle large datasets
- Techniques for optimizing database performance
These lessons help learners think like database professionals rather than beginners.
Coupon code: EDB38E969D59FE86B903
Practical Learning with Real-World Examples
One of the strongest aspects of this course is its hands-on approach. Instead of only watching videos, learners actively practice SQL queries and database operations.
You will:
- Work with realistic database examples
- Solve practical query problems
- Understand common mistakes and how to fix them
- Apply SQL concepts in scenarios similar to real jobs
This practice-driven method ensures long-term retention and real skill development.
Who Should Take This SQL and MySQL Course?
This course is designed for a broad audience, making it valuable across multiple career paths.
Beginners with No Technical Background
If you are new to databases or programming, this course starts from the absolute basics. Concepts are explained clearly, making it easy to follow even without prior experience.
Students and Fresh Graduates
SQL is one of the most requested skills in entry-level tech roles. Students who complete this course gain a strong advantage in:
- Campus placements
- Technical interviews
- Internship opportunities
Software and Web Developers
Developers frequently interact with databases. This course helps developers:
- Write efficient backend queries
- Understand database structure deeply
- Reduce application errors related to data handling
SQL knowledge improves both backend and full-stack development capabilities.
Data Analysts and Business Analysts
Data professionals rely heavily on SQL for:
- Extracting reports
- Cleaning and transforming data
- Supporting business decisions
This course provides the exact SQL skills needed for analytics roles.
Working Professionals Seeking Career Growth
Professionals from non-technical backgrounds can also benefit. SQL is widely used in:
- Operations
- Finance
- Marketing analytics
- Reporting roles
Learning SQL opens doors to higher-paying, data-oriented positions.
Key Skills You Gain After Completing the Course
By the end of this course, learners develop a strong technical toolkit, including:
- Confidence in writing complex SQL queries
- Ability to design structured relational databases
- Skills to join and analyze data across multiple tables
- Knowledge of performance tuning and optimization
- Practical problem-solving ability using SQL
These skills are directly applicable to real-world work environments.
Why This Course Stands Out from Other SQL Courses
Many online SQL tutorials focus only on syntax. This course goes further by teaching how and why SQL works, not just what commands to type.
Clear Learning Path
The content is organized logically, ensuring learners are never confused or overwhelmed.
Practical Focus
Every concept is supported by examples and exercises, bridging the gap between theory and practice.
Beginner-Friendly Yet Advanced
The course grows with the learner, starting simple and progressing to advanced topics smoothly.
Lifetime Skill Value
SQL is a timeless skill. Once mastered, it remains useful across industries and technologies.
Career Opportunities After Learning SQL and MySQL
SQL remains one of the most in-demand skills across the global job market. Professionals with strong SQL knowledge are hired for roles such as:
- Data Analyst
- Business Intelligence Analyst
- Backend Developer
- Database Administrator
- Data Engineer (entry-level)
As organizations increasingly rely on data-driven decisions, SQL expertise becomes more valuable every year.
Long-Term Benefits of Mastering SQL
Learning SQL is not just about landing a job — it’s about building a foundation for long-term growth.
With SQL skills, you can:
- Transition into advanced data roles
- Learn big data technologies more easily
- Understand how enterprise systems work
- Make informed technical decisions
SQL often acts as a gateway skill to data science, cloud computing, and analytics careers.
Final Conclusion
If you are serious about learning databases the right way, “Mastering SQL with MySQL: From Basics to Advanced” is a powerful learning resource. It combines beginner-friendly explanations with advanced concepts, practical exercises, and real-world relevance.
This course does more than teach SQL commands — it builds a deep understanding of how data systems function. Whether you are a student, developer, analyst, or career switcher, mastering SQL with MySQL can significantly strengthen your professional profile and future opportunities.
In a world driven by data, SQL is not optional — it is essential. And this course provides a clear, structured, and effective path to mastering it.
Click here to enroll – The Complete HTML Course 2025 – Learn HTML from Scratch with Masterclass
Join now and start building your first project today!
Make the next 30 days the most productive coding days of your life. By the end, you’ll not only understand JavaScript – you’ll be able to build almost anything with it.
Please Join in WHATSAPP GROUP
Please Join in TELEGRAM GROUP
If anyone have interest on GOVT jobs – Please click on this below link
GOVT JOBS




